Bitcoin (BTC) ETFs Add $396M and Ethereum (ETH) ETFs Add $471M in Net Inflows — BlackRock iShares Leads Aug 11 Update
According to @lookonchain, 10 Bitcoin ETFs recorded net inflows of +3,308 BTC worth $396.03M on Aug 11, led by iShares (BlackRock) with +3,089 BTC worth $369.73M and a current holding of 742,451 BTC valued at $88.88B, source: @lookonchain. According to @lookonchain, 9 Ethereum ETFs recorded net inflows of +112,031 ETH worth $470.76M on Aug 11, with iShares (BlackRock) contributing +62,936 ETH worth $264.46M, source: @lookonchain. |

Ethereum (ETH) ETFs Log $461M Net Inflows on Aug 8, 2025 — ETHA $254.7M, FETH $132.3M Lead
According to @FarsideUK, total US-listed Ethereum ETF net inflows reached $461 million on Aug 8, 2025, based on Farside Investors data published on X and farside.co.uk/eth/. ETHA led with $254.7 million, followed by FETH at $132.3 million, ETHE at $26.8 million, and ETH at $38.2 million, as reported by Farside Investors via X and farside.co.uk/eth/. ETHW posted $7.8 million and QETH $1.2 million, while CETH, ETHV, and EZET recorded zero net flow for the day, per Farside Investors’ X post and website. For traders, creations were concentrated in ETHA and FETH, indicating where primary market demand clustered among US Ethereum ETFs on the day, according to Farside Investors’ published flow data. |

Singapore MAS Offshore Crypto Crackdown Linked to 3AC and Terraform; ETH's 40% Surge Signals Altcoin Rally Amid Geopolitical Volatility
According to Charmaine Tam, Head of OTC at Hex Trust, Ethereum's recent outperformance against bitcoin serves as a leading indicator for capital flows into altcoins, with ETH dominance rising to nearly 10% and BTC dominance falling 2-3 percentage points, signaling a shift towards DeFi, modular infrastructure, and decentralized AI sectors. Tam noted that institutional demand, including over $1.25 billion in spot ETH ETF inflows since mid-May, supports this trend. Geopolitical tensions from Israeli airstrikes on Iran caused BTC to drop 4.7% to $103.3K and ETH to $2,694, though ETH remains up 40% over three months. Simultaneously, Singapore's Monetary Authority of Singapore has mandated licensing for offshore crypto firms by June 30, leading to shutdowns of exchanges like Bitget and Bybit, a move influenced by past issues with Three Arrows Capital and Terraform Labs that lacked local oversight. |
